Once upon a time there was a girl, who from a very young age, loved to draw. Holly was her name, and she remembers receiving a gift, a set of pencils and a drawing pad. She will always think of that gift as the start of her artistic career. As a ten-year old, she like to drawn things like house plans. Maybe a little odd for a ten-year old, but artist don’t always fit the mold.
So in 1987, Holly graduated from the University of Arizona with a BA in Studio Art & Graphic Design and moved to California. She worked for a couple of design firms specializing in the High Tech industry before going out on her own. Now, a few of Holly’s favorite things to create are logos, custom invitations, commissioned pet portraits in watercolor or acrylics and re-purposed painted furniture.
Holly now lives in beautiful Southern Oregon with her husband and three children in a home she designed herself. I guess that ‘odd’ hobby paid off.
